About HAYBRIDGE HIGH SCHOOL ASSOCIATION

HAYBRIDGE HIGH SCHOOL ASSOCIATION is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1019148).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Verified" rating with a CharityScore of 80/100 — a well-rated and transparent charity that meets strong governance standards. This indicates a reliable charity with strong fundamentals across most of our assessment criteria. In its most recent reporting year (2025), HAYBRIDGE HIGH SCHOOL ASSOCIATION reported a total income of £10,985 and total expenditure of £6,114, a spending ratio of 56% suggesting a reasonable but not exceptional allocation to charitable activities. According to the Charity Commission register, HAYBRIDGE HIGH SCHOOL ASSOCIATION describes its activities as follows: Fundraising events for school equipment etc. e.g. Quiz nights, xmas fayre, catering, fashion shows etc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for HAYBRIDGE HIGH SCHOOL ASSOCIATION.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
